Farnell element14 has announced some of its plans for this year's Embedded World exhibition in Nuremburg.

The company will be demonstrating its latest embedded design solutions including software development tools, development boards, ARM based designs, pcb design software and fabrication services that support developers from initial specification through to final prototype. Additionally the company will be providing demonstrations of the Knode on element14 - the web based end to end design service that automates the creation and assembly of embedded design flow solutions. Launched in June 2011, the Knode on element14 has been supporting the complete design flow from concept to tested prototype and enabling engineers to research, compare, design and prototype manufacture in a single, intelligent environment. At the show, visitors will be able to learn first hand how they can access the latest products as well as exclusive development kits and tools easily and quickly via the Knode, and how by automating the configuration of product design flow solutions, valuable engineering resource can be increasingly focused on application design and IP creation. Richard Hammerl, technical support manager of CadSoft Computer will be hosting live demonstrations of the latest v6 EAGLE PCB design tool which provides new functionality for the designer and drives design flow efficiencies by integrating pcb design with component selection and pcb fabrication. Partners including Embest and Micrium will be joining Farnell element14 on the stand daily with a guest manufacturer each day. Freescale, Analog Devices and Microchip will be on stand displaying their latest embedded design tools and resources. Farnell element14 will be exhibiting on Stand # 5.236.
